Product news:
Domaine de la Graveirette new wines are in next week including:
• 2010 Cotes du Rhone, 100% Grenache RRP £12.95. A departure from the syrah Grenache blend, and very 2010.
• 2010 Mus Blanc and Merlot VdP vaucluse to stellar sub £10 wines that really hit the spot
• He has produced a white wine from CdP vineyards that will be out early summer. For now it is VdFrance and will be circa £15 as it is from young vines, but it is good!
• 2009 CdP. Amazing!

Thomas Labaille Sancerre
• A new Rose is on its way and some 2010 Pinot Noir. Fine, restrained styles and very elegant.

Jean Franois Merieau
• 2010 Arpent de Vaudons Sauvignon Blanc, a terroir style SB for £11.95, beautifully packaged and knock out value.
• 2008 Grands Champs Cabernet Franc, an evolved and very characterful CF from the master. £13.95

Patrick Piuze
• 2011 Petit Chablis is now in stock, with 2011 Fye in bottles and Magnums to follow in April.

Agricola Labastida Rioja
• These guys have made a £7.95 retail Rioja for us and it is fabulous, 100% Tempranillo from Alevesa, its juicy and very fruity. This replace Pierres Rioja. We have a Crianza too. 2008 vintage.

Deliance
• 2009 Givry has arrived rrp £16.95, and is very fine indeed.
